Question:
There are 10 orange sodas, 15 cream sodas, and 7 cherry sodas in an ice chest. How many sodas must be removed from the ice chest to guarantee that one of each type of soda has been chosen?
A. 16
B. 18
C. 23
D. 25
E. 26
